N010257 TeNo PERSONNEL'S CUFFTITLE. (Ärmelstreiffen)  

BACKGROUND: The TeNo, Technischen Nothilfe, (Technical Emergency Corps), was originally established in September 1919, of trained, voluntary, civilian personnel to maintain and repair essential services in the event of a natural disaster or emergency. Many of its personnel were ex-service men and a large amount of them had some type of specialized technical training which was key to its mandate. TeNo was a civilian organization administered under the Minister of the Interior, until mid-1939 when it became an official State organization under control of the Police which in turn was controlled by the SS. With this change in status a small nucleus of salaried Officials were employed to run the organization. As the war dragged on TeNo, became more and more a para-military organization with its direction becoming more controlled by the Waffen-SS. When TeNo personnel were attached to army units for assistance they were issued with one of two distinctive cufftitles with one cufftitle being worked in bright silver/aluminum threads for wear on the field-grey service tunic and the other cufftitle worked in matte silvery/grey threads for wear on the fatigue and work tunic. 

PHYSICAL DESCRIPTION: Roughly, 1 1/2" tall, 16" long, ribbed black rayon construction cufftitle with BeVo woven Gothic script, "Technische Nothilfe" in bright silver/aluminum threads for wear on the field-grey service tunic. The reverse of the cufftitle has the typical loose, vertical threads from the weaving process. There are several stains on one end, from where stickers or tags were attached to it at one time, would probably clean up is done carefully. The cufftitle is in overall good condition with light age and usage toning and light to moderate fraying to the unfinished ends.
